The 2017 of Jakarta Election is not only enlivened by the comments of politicians and experts , but also followed by the general public in a critical, obscene, and massive way. This study aimed to reveal the ideology in public opinions about the discourse of Jakarta election at social media. This research used qualitative-descriptive approach with content analysis method, and based on the critical discourse analysis theory by Norman Fairclough. The result of the research showed (1) about 57.4% of public opinions represent ideology of Islamic religion by raising the issue of the importance of Aqeedah, Sharia, and morals for leaders, through vocabularies like the similar faith, fellow moeslems, humane, and dirt, (2) a number of 34.8% show the ideology of secularism with the issue of electing the government leaders not a religious leader through the use of vocabularies such as performance, don’t, clean, not corrupt; while (3) just 7.8% represent the ideology of liberalism with the issue such as no offense for the public to choose their leader through the use of vocabularies such as freedom, logical thinking, realistic, and common sense.
This research aims to describe the influences of TPS model and reading interest of class VIII student of SMP Negeri 31 Padang about their skills of writing explanatory text. This research type is quantitative research with 2x2 factorial experiment design. The population of this research is all students of class VIII SMP Negeri 31 Padan. The data collects by using two methods. The analysis and discussion of the data apply descriptive-analysis method in accordance with the concept of experimental research. Based on the research the writer concludes that from explanatory text writing, the students who have high reading interest and low reading interest whom applies TPS model have higher reading interest than the students that using conventional learning methods. Furthermore, there is no interaction between TPS model with reading interest in influencing the learning outcomes of the students' in explanatory text writing skills.
This article aims to reveal philosophy level from axiology (use) of literature in the society of Minangkabau’s superstition viewed from cultural manifestation. This research is a content analysis researh using descriptive qualitative method. The research was done in 10 places in Luhak Kubuang Tigo Baleh Minangkabau namely Salayo, Cupak, Gantuang Ciri, Guguak, Koto Anau, Muara Paneh, Kota Solok, Talang, Panyangkalan, dan Kinari.The data in this research is the statements of superstition in KubuangTigoBaleh society which is obtained from observation and indepth interview withpenghulu, cerdik pandai, and alim ulama. In analyzing the data, the research usedMiles danHubeman’s modelsthrough three steps (1) data reduction, (2) data display and (3) conclusion. Based on the findings it can be concluded that There are four patterns of superstition, namely negative, positive, prediction and witchcraft pattern. Moreover, in the process of pattern meaning the lofty ethic values are framed and considered as local wisdom of the Minangkabau society, especially in KubuangTigoBaleh which is appropriate, well-mannered, educated and existence acknowledged as a belief.
Jakarta Election 2017 was a phenomenal one from many points of views including aspect of language use as political tool. Therefore, this study aims to describe the politeness level of politicians in the discourse of Jakarta election 2017 at online portal news. This research used a qualitative approach with descriptive method. Analyzing the data was exercised by content analysis method with the application of language politeness theory from Brown-Levinson and Leech. Based on data analysis, politicians are more dominant to convey their ideas through a rhetorical style of irony, expressive speech acts, and vague strategies; they also tend to violate rather than adhere to the politeness principle so, it was ‘high potential’ to threaten the face of the intended person or party. Based on the findings of this research, the level of language politeness performed by politicians in Jakarta Election is represented in three divisions; about 48% of comments of the politicians are at an ‘impolite’, 15% are at ‘less polite’ level, and only 36% are in the ‘polite’ category.
Minangkabau is one of the hundreds of cultures that exist in Indonesia. As a community, ethnic Minangkabau have moral teachings, values and societal norms. Those values, ethnics, and behaviors regarded as a source of policy in a community‘s life is called as local wisdom. Literature work is a product of wisdom that is able to provide enlightenment for those who appreciate it. Literature can be defined as manifestation of one‘s cultural expression and reflection. Thus, literature may enrich the life of the readers through reading, writing, listening and discussing it. It may directly or indirectly enrich life of the readers through experience enlightenment and problems issued in one work of literature as well as its solution. In this study, the Minangkabau local wisdom content can be one of guidance in life. This study is pursuant to the theory of literature sociology which regards literature as manifestation of cultural experience as well as reflection of social-cultural reality. Based on the study, it is found that the content related to the local wisdom in modern short stories written by Minangkabau authors discusses five particular local wisdom. The first one related to life philosophy of Minangkabaunese; standing for what is right and enemies will never be challenged, yet they will not be avoided when they come. The second one is local wisdom based on Minangkabaunese‘s social life like giving advice, teachings, helping others, saving the earnings, taking a lesson from others‘ experiences, and preserving the natural sacred surroundings. The third one is local wisdom related to local ceremony or traditional ceremony. This ceremony will be a forum for the local people to train their diplomatic skills and local cooperation. The forth is local wisdom belonging to local principles, norms, and regulations which are actuated in social system. These can be reflected to in Minangkabaunese behaviours who are always becoming hard worker, never be proud of their belongings and ability, making advantage of their natural surroundings, sharing intra-marriage system and respecting women. The fifth is local wisdom which is based on tradition, daily basis social attitude, namely; ways of living in a community, waiting for children with traditional foods, provide assistance for construction of public facilities, helping others and returning home when Ramadhan month is coming.
